.TBodyMain {                                                                                                        
background-color: #fafafa;

background-image: url("/themes/default/images/head-fon.jpg");                                                     
background-repeat: no-repeat;
background-position: top center;
margin: 0px;                                                                                                 
}

.TBodyAdmin {                                                                                                        
background-color: #aad8ff;
background-repeat: no-repeat;                                                                                 
margin: 0px;                                                                                                 
}


.TBoxHead {
color: white;
/*background-color: silver;*/
background-color: d0a64c; 
border-style: solid;                                                                                           
border-width: 1px;                                                                                             
border-color: 7b5400;
font-family: arial;                                                                                           
font-size: 11pt;
font-style: italic;
margin: 0px;
padding: 0px;
}

.TBoxBody {
background-image: url("/themes/default/images/box_bg.jpg");
background-color: #ffeeca; 
font-family: arial;                                                                                           
font-size: 11pt;
font-style: italic;
padding: 5px;
}

TABLE.MainTable {
border-style: none;
border-width: 1px;
margin-top: 20px;
}

TD.CenterBox {
background-color: #fffaec;
padding:5px;
}

TD.TopBanner {
border-width: 1px;
border-style: solid;
border-color: #006bc6;
width: 778px;
height: 100px;
background-color: #ffffff;
font-family: arial;
font-size: medium;
font-style: normal;
margin-top: 5px;
margin-right:5px;
margin-bottom:5px;
margin-left:25px;
}

.Tools {
/*background-color: #f0f0f0;*/
border-style: none;
border-width: 1px;
border-color: #5555ff;
font-family: arial;                                                                                           
font-size: small;                                                                                            
font-style: normal; 
font-weight: 100;
}

TABLE.TMenu {
font-family: arial; 
font-size: small;                                                                                            
font-style: normal;
/*background-color: #ffffff;*/
background-color: #ffeeca;
border-style: solid;
border-width: 1px;
border-color: #555555;
margin-top: 5px;
margin-right: 5px;
margin-bottom: 5px;
margin-left: 0px; 
padding: 0px;
}

A.TMenuString {
vertical-align: middle;
text-decoration: none;
/*color: #0000ff;*/
color: #006bc6;
font-family: arial;                                                                                           
font-size: medium;                                                                                            
font-style: normal;                                                                                           
font-weight: 100; 
}

TABLE.TMainWindow {
background-color: #ffffff;
border-style: solid;
border-width: 1px;
border-color: #555555;
margin-top: 5px;
margin-right: 10px;
margin-bottom: 0px;
margin-left: 0px; 
padding: 0px;
}

TABLE.TBottomTable {
color: #222222;
background-color: silver;
border-style: dotted;
border-width: 1px;
border-color: #555555;
margin: 10px;
font-family: arial;                                                                                           
font-size: small;                                                                                             
font-style: normal;                                                                                           
font-weight: 100;
}

.continue_text {
text-decoration: none;                                                                                        
color: #555555;                                                                                               
font-family: arial;                                                                                           
font-size: small;                                                                                            
font-style: normal;                                                                                           
font-weight: 100; 
}

.news_short {
text-decoration: none;                                                                                        
color: #000000;                                                                                               
font-family: arial;                                                                                           
font-size: 11pt;                                                                                             
font-style: normal;                                                                                           
font-weight: 100; 
}

INPUT.text_field {
background-color: #fafafa;
border-style: solid;
border-width: 1px;
border-color: #006bc6;
}

.submit_btn {
text-decoration: none;
color: black;
font-family: arial;                                                                                           
font-size: 10pt;                                                                                             
font-style: normal;                                                                                           
font-weight: 100; 
background-color: #aad8ff;
border-style: solid;
border-width: 1px;
border-color: #006bc6;
padding-top: 2px;
padding-bottom: 2px;
padding-left: 6px;
padding-right: 6px;
}

.chop {
text-decoration: none;                                                                                        
color: #006bc6;                                                                                               
font-family: arial;                                                                                           
font-size: 11pt;                                                                                              
font-style: normal;                                                                                           
font-weight: 100;  
}

.errmsg {
background-color: yellow;
color: red;
border-style: solid;
border-width: 1px;
border-color: red;
padding-left: 9px;
font-family: arial;                                                                                           
font-size: 10pt;                                                                                              
font-style: normal;                                                                                           
font-weight: 100;
}

.ssfmsg {
background-color: #aad8ff;
color: black;
border-style: solid;
border-width: 1px;
border-color: #006bc6;
padding-left: 9px;
font-family: arial;                                                                                           
font-size: 10pt;                                                                                              
font-style: normal;                                                                                           
font-weight: 100;
}

.attention {
color: red;
font-family: arial;
font-size: small;
font-style: bold;
font-weight: 300;
}

.plain_bold_text {
color: red ;
font-family: arial;
font-size: small;
font-style: normal;
font-weight: bold;
}

.plain_text {
color: black;
font-family: arial;
font-size: small;
font-style: normal;
font-weight: 100;
}

.infobox {
background-color: d0a64c;
color: white;
border-style: solid;
border-width: 1px;
border-color: 7b5400;
padding: 3px;
font-family: arial,serif;
font-style: normal;
font-weight: normal;
font-size: medium;
}

.admin_menu_box {
border-style:solid;
border-width:1px;
border-color:black;
padding:3px;
}

.decor_link {
text-decoration:none;
color: #7b5400;
}
